Missing defines preventing recursive includesion in some include/sys/*.h files

This commit is contained in:
Tomas Hruby 2009-08-17 14:34:14 +00:00
parent d1b4c5be5b
commit bd2dd15cc6
3 changed files with 12 additions and 0 deletions

View File

@ -1,5 +1,9 @@
#ifndef __SYS_PARAM_H__
#define __SYS_PARAM_H__
/* /*
sys/param.h sys/param.h
*/ */
#define MAXHOSTNAMELEN 256 /* max hostname size */ #define MAXHOSTNAMELEN 256 /* max hostname size */
#endif /* __SYS_PARAM_H__ */

View File

@ -1,3 +1,6 @@
#ifndef __SYS_VM_H__
#define __SYS_VM_H__
/* /*
sys/vm.h sys/vm.h
*/ */
@ -23,3 +26,4 @@ struct mapreqvm
void *vaddr_ret; void *vaddr_ret;
}; };
#endif /* __SYS_VM_H__ */

View File

@ -1,3 +1,5 @@
#ifndef __SYS_VM_386_H__
#define __SYS_VM_386_H__
/* /*
sys/vm_i386.h sys/vm_i386.h
*/ */
@ -63,3 +65,5 @@ sys/vm_i386.h
/* CPUID flags */ /* CPUID flags */
#define CPUID1_EDX_PSE (1L << 3) /* Page Size Extension */ #define CPUID1_EDX_PSE (1L << 3) /* Page Size Extension */
#define CPUID1_EDX_PGE (1L << 13) /* Page Global (bit) Enable */ #define CPUID1_EDX_PGE (1L << 13) /* Page Global (bit) Enable */
#endif /* __SYS_VM_386_H__ */